It was reported in the June 23, 1977, edition of the Journal, the grand opening of Gemini Jewelers, owned by Darryl Hetrick.
The store, located in the River Falls Mall,109 N. Main St., was to be open Mondays through Saturdays, 9 a.m. to 5:30 p.m., and until 9 p.m. Thursdays. Free roses were given to lady customers during the grand opening, and 20% off all stock items. Ear piercings were also available for $7.
From 1978-1988 Gemini Jewelers was located at 119 S. Main St., from 1988-1999 at 118 S. Main St., and from 1999 to the present at 120 S. Main St. Note the other businesses located in River Falls Mall along with Gemini Jewelers: Shoes and Sports, Lancer, Fashion Garden, Kirby Co., Photo Fair, Country Road, Sound, Sight &Sports, and Elenore’s Fabrics.
